The Edmonton Oilers (0-2) and Nashville Predators (1-2) face off Tuesday at Bridgestone Arena. Puck drop is 8 p.m. ET (ESPN+/Hulu). Below, we analyze BetMGM Sportsbook’s'lines around the Oilers vs. Predators odds, and make our expert NHL picks and predictions.

The Oilers dropped their 1st 2 games by a combined score of 12-4 to the Vancouver Canucks to open the season. Their last game was extremely puzzling as they outshot the Canucks 40-18 and only took 3 penalties and still lost 4-3.

The Preds fell to the Boston Bruins 3-2 on Saturday to fall to 1-2. All 3 goals came on the power play or a penalty shot. Meanwhile, Nashville was 0-for-7 with the man advantage. They are just 1-for-14 on the power play in 3 games. Meanwhile, they’ve allowed opponents to convert on 4-for-12 power plays.
